要监控Debian上的Jenkins运行状态,您可以使用以下几种方法:
使用Jenkins内置插件
Jenkins自带了一些监控插件,它们无需额外安装,能帮助您快速了解系统的运行状态,并及时发现潜在问题。
使用Jenkins API
通过调用Jenkins的REST API,您可以获取构建的状态和结果信息。例如,使用curl命令获取特定job的最新构建信息。这种方法提供了更大的灵活性,允许开发者或自动化脚本实时获取构建状态,便于集成到其他监控或日志分析系统中。
使用Jenkins监控插件
安装并使用Jenkins插件,如Email Extension Plugin (发送邮件通知)、Slack Notification Plugin (发送Slack通知)等。这些插件可以在构建过程中自动发送通知,包括状态和结果信息,从而及时响应构建状态的变化。
使用第三方监控工具
利用第三方工具,如Jenkins Monitoring and Alerting System (Jenkins-monitor),帮助监控Jenkins集群的状态和性能,并提供实时警报。这些工具通常提供丰富的可视化界面和报警机制,有助于快速发现和解决构建过程中的问题。
通过上述方法,您可以有效地监控和管理Debian上的Jenkins运行状态,确保其稳定运行并及时发现潜在问题。